Talented actor Nakuul Mehta has delivered winning turns on television and got himself a fast-growing global fan base in the process, who watch his every move and shower him with love. One of these dedicated super fans is Mansha Johny from Bandung, Indonesia.
Eastern Eye caught up with Mansha to find out more.
Tell us, what first connected you to Nakuul Mehta?
The first thing that really connected me with Nakuul was his character Shivaay in drama serial Ishqbaaaz. That connection has only grown since then.
What made you become a super fan?
I sent a gift for his birthday, which was a photo frame. When he received that gift, it was broken into many pieces. But he did not throw it and said he will replace the glass, and frame it in his house. He is the most humble person ever.
What has been your most memorable moment?
The day I met Naakul was the most memorable and I was in awe of him. He was asking my name and I could not answer as I was in shock. Then he gave me a hug. He is a sweetheart and a gentleman.
Tell us about something super you have done for Nakuul?
Naakul’s last two birthdays I celebrated with poor kids, cut cakes with them, played games and gave them gifts. In 2017, I went to Mumbai only to meet him.
What is the thing you most love about Nakuul?
I love his nature and I get positive vibes from him. He loves and respects everyone around him.
Which quality in the celebrity do you most relate to?
Like him, I try to spread positive vibes and live life to the fullest.
What is your favourite work Nakuul has done?
I love Naakul in all the roles he has played - from Adi to Shivaay to Shivaansh. He is a brilliant actor.
Why do you love being a super fan?
I love being a super fan because it enables me to do super things for my idol Nakuul, which includes helping others.

Charli XCX is swapping stadium lights for the cinema glow, and everyone’s already buzzing. Her new A24 film, The Moment, just dropped a cast list that has people talking. With Kylie Jenner and Alexander Skarsgård in the cast, this movie looks set to crash right through the usual pop star movie expectations. The promise is a look behind the sparkle, showing the mess, giving us the real underbelly of the music world.
Alexander Skarsgård joins Charli XCX’s star-packed film The Moment with Kylie Jenner Instagram Screengrab/kyliejenner/Getty Images
What’s the plot of The Moment?
It’s Charli playing, well, a pop star, trying to keep her head above water as she is sucked into the vortex of fame and pressure. She’s prepping for her first arena tour, dodging the industry sharks and probably a crisis or three. It’s all a bit meta here. Charli’s been through the whole thing already; the chaos, the lights, the late nights. She’s seen what fame looks like when the glitter fades. It started with Charli tossing out an idea, half-formed, then Aidan Zamiri and Bertie Brandes shaped it into something that actually breathes.
This cast is like someone spun a wheel of celebrities. Kylie Jenner’s making her big acting debut, Skarsgård and Arquette bring that serious actor energy, and then you have comedy geniuses Rachel Sennott and Kate Berlant to stir things up. Add in a squad of models, artists, and Charli’s long-time music partner A. G. Cook, who’s handling the soundtrack, obviously. Huge? That’s an understatement.

When will The Moment be released?
2026 is the target, so we need to wait. They have got time to make it weird, wonderful, or both. Charli’s calling the shots under her Studio365 label, and you can tell. Every part of it seems to carry her touch: the look, the sound, the attitude. It’s a big jump for her, crossing into film like this. Whether it lands as something great or gets people arguing about it, it’s not going to slide by quietly.
